			            Original DescriptionHendrick Goltzius's Vertumnus and Pomona (1613) is a masterful engraving that captures the mythical romance between the Roman deities with extraordinary detail and dynamism. The scene depicts Vertumnus, the god of seasons and change, disguised as an old woman to woo the reclusive nymph Pomona, who devoted herself solely to gardening. Goltzius’s intricate linework and dramatic use of chiaroscuro heighten the tension and intimacy of the moment, as Vertumnus’s persuasive gestures contrast with Pomona’s initially hesitant posture—a nod to Ovid’s Metamorphoses. The work exemplifies Goltzius’s Late Mannerist style, blending exaggerated anatomy and fluid movement with Northern Renaissance precision. Regarded as one of his finest prints, it showcases his technical brilliance in engraving and his ability to infuse mythological narratives with psychological depth, solidifying his reputation as a pivotal figure between Renaissance and Baroque printmaking.
